Neal Zierler

According to our database1, Neal Zierler authored at least 12 papers between 1960 and 1973.

Awards

IEEE Fellow

IEEE Fellow 1979, "For the application of finite mathematics to the design and analysis of communication systems, including error-correcting-codes and cryptology.".
